Trontek Unveils Powercube 1.4 kWh & 2.7 kWh for Energy Storage

Trontek, a lithium-ion battery manufacturer, entered the residential energy storage market with the launch of Powercube 1.4 kWh and Powercube 2.7 kWh. These are the company’s first direct-to-home lithium-ion battery systems designed to deliver reliable, long-life, and solar-integrated backup power for Indian households.

Strategic Shift Toward Consumer-Centric Solutions

With this launch, Trontek moves beyond its strong position as a leading OEM supplier and steps into the consumer energy solutions space. The Powercube range is available in 1.4 kWh and 2.7 kWh capacities, each in Standard and Premium variants.

The Standard series includes the Powercube 1.4 with a compact SOC indicator and the 2.7 model without an SOC display.

The Premium 1.4+ kWh and 2.7+ kWh models feature an advanced LED status display for better visibility and monitoring.

Trontek will roll out the full range across regions with high rooftop solar usage, growing home energy needs, and frequent power interruptions.

Built on Proven Lithium-Ion Expertise

Leveraging two decades of engineering experience, advanced BMS architecture, and robust safety testing, Trontek brings its proven capabilities from electric mobility and industrial applications directly into homes. The Powercube series supports both grid backup and hybrid solar setups, offering:

*Higher storage efficiency

*Longer lifecycle

*Superior performance compared to lead-acid batteries

This makes the systems ideal for modern, energy-conscious homes seeking cleaner and smarter power alternatives.

Availability and Consumer Awareness Initiatives

As per the press release, Powercube 1.4 kWh and 2.7 kWh systems will be available through Trontek’s authorised distributors and channel partners. The company also plans awareness programs to educate consumers on the benefits of lithium-ion storage. This is especially for solar-linked homes, where charging time, efficiency, and lifecycle matter.
